Alagappa Chettiar College of Engineering and Technology, Karaikudi admissions are offered at undergraduate and postgraduate levels. ACCET Karaikudi admissions to the courses are granted based on entrance examination and merit of the qualifying examination followed by the counselling process.
ACCET admissions to the BE courses are based the scores of class 10+2 or equivalent examination and TNEA counselling process. ACCET Karaikudi admissions to the ME course is based on CEETA PG and the counselling process. Interested candidates need to apply for ACCET Karaikudi by filling up the application form.

ACCET Karaikudi BE admission is based on class 12th scores and the TNEA counselling process. Candidates must meet ACCET Karaikudi eligibility criteria, apply through the TNEA website, and participate in the counselling process.
ACCET Karaikudi ME admission requires candidates to qualify for the CEETA PG entrance exam, followed by counselling. Admission to ACCET Karaikudi ME courses is based on entrance scores and document verification.
ACCET Karaikudi BE admission offers 900 seats across various specialisations. Candidates must fulfil ACCET Karaikudi eligibility criteria and undergo the TNEA counselling process for admission.
Candidates must provide class 10th and 12th certificates, entrance exam scorecards, caste and income certificates, and other required documents for ACCET Karaikudi admission verification.
Candidates can apply for ACCET Karaikudi admission by visiting the official website, downloading the application form, filling in the required details, uploading necessary documents, and submitting the form with the ACCET Karaikudi application fees.

I am studying Electronics and Communication Engineering (ECE) because it offers a strong blend of hardware and software knowledge, which is essential in today’s tech-driven world. The quality of teaching is good, with most faculty members being experienced and supportive. They explain core subjects clearly and also encourage practical learning. The curriculum follows the 2022 regulations and includes updated topics like IoT, VLSI, embedded systems, and AI basics. Though the syllabus is slightly demanding, it prepares us well for placements and real-world applications. Seminars, workshops, and industrial visits further help bridge the gap between academics and industry. Overall, it is a good academic environment that helps students become job-ready.
